Srinagar – Women Only Group Tour

Srinagar  05 NIGHT / 06 DAYS
2N Pahalgam – 1N Gulmarg – 2N Srinagar Package Cost : INR 44,500

14th April          Srinagar – Pahalgam
Reach Srinagar Airport. Pickup & Transfer to Pahalgam. – 98 Kms. – 2.5 Hrs, Arrive at Pahalgam (the valley of shepherds) and transfer to Hotel, Dinner and overnight stay in hotel at Pahalgam.

15th April            In Pahalgam
Local Pahalgam sightseeing in Morning. Free for individual activities, Visit Chandanwari and Aru. Ponies ( self as union in pahalgam dose not permit this travel for non local taxis ). Lunch/dinner and Overnight stay in hotel.
16th April             Pahalgam – Srinagar – Gulmarg
After breakfast drive to Gulmarg via Srinagar. The distance of 144 Kms. Will be covered in about 4 hrs. En route, visiting saffron fields and Awantipura Ruins (1100 years old temple of lord Vishnu built by king Awantivarman), enjoy the beautiful countryside on the way. Drive through the pine forest. Reach Gulmarg by 2:00 pm. Gulmarg has one of best ski slopes in the world, and one of the highest golf courses in the world with 18 holes. View of Nanga Parbat if the weather permits. Fascinating views from Tangmarg to Gulmarg. A short trek up to Khilanmarg, which can be covered in about 3 hrs. is Optional. The Gondola Lift for mountain rides in also available. Stay overnight in Gulmarg.
17th April            Gulmarg – Srinagar
After Breakfast & half day Gulmarg sightseeing. Leave for Srinagar The distance of 56 Kms – 2 Hrs. Reception upon arrival and transfer to Deluxe Houseboat/Hotel. Afternoon sightseeing of the Mughal Gardens visiting Nishat Bagh built by Asaf Khan, the brother-in-law of Jehangir in 1632 A.D., and Shalimar Bagh built by Jehangir for his wife empress Nur Jahan. All the Gardens are situated on the bank of the Dal Lake with the Zabarwan hills in the background. En route the gardens, visit a carpet weaving factory. Evening Shikara ride on the Dal Lake, visiting floating/ vegetable gardens. Dinner and overnight stay in Deluxe Houseboat/Hotel.
18th April             Srinagar – Sonamarg – Srinagar
Full day excursion to Sonmarg by car. The distance of about 83 Kms. Will be Covered in about 3 Hrs. time Sonamarg lies in Sindh Valley strewn with flowers and surrounded by mountains. Sonamarg is also the base for some interesting treks to high altitude Himalayan Lakes.  Drive back from Sonamarg and transfer to deluxe Houseboat/Hotel for dinner and overnight stay.
19th April             Leave Srinagar
After Breakfast Drop at Srinagar Airport. Flight from Srinagar in afternoon. Reach Indore in evening.

22nd May                 Delhi – Arrive Leh; 3505 meters / 11567 feet.
Arrive Kushok Bakula airport Leh – 3500m above sea level. Transfer to hotel. Breakfast at the hotel before 09.30 am. Half Day at rest for acclimatization.Lunch at the hotel. After Lunch drive to Visit Shanti Stupa & Leh Palace, Later in the evening walk around local market. Overnight stay at the Hote. (B,L,D)
23rd May                Drive Sham Valley & Alchi -70km
After breakfast,Be ready by 8:30 Am.Leave for River Rafting in Nimmoo 34Kms.(48 Min.) with Lunch. After Lunch arround 1:30Pm leave for Alchi 32Kms (40 min.). Sightseeing of 1000 year old Alchi monastery the only Gompa in Ladakh region on flat ground. Thereafter proceed to the Likir Monastrey 19Kms. (30 Min.) to visit the splendid three storeys Dharma Wheel Gompa. Here you’ll be awestruck with the sight of the massive Buddha statues. Indus & Zanskar river Sangam, drive along the Indus river visiting, Pathar Sahib Gurdwara and Magnetic Hill(where the cars defy gravity), Basgo Palace Hiking only and further on to Leh Hall of Fame (which has a museum of the Kargil War memorabilia)Dinner and Over Night at the Hotel in Leh. (B,L,D)
24th May                Leh – Pangong Lake (4 Hrs One Way – 140 Kms)
Early Morning After Breakfast around 9 Am Leave For Pangong Lake (14,500 Ft) Through Changla Pass 17,350 Ft. (Third Highest Motorable Road In The World). Visit The Beautiful Pangong Lake Which Forms A Part Of The Border Area Between India And China. This Large, Serene Lake At An Altitude Of 13,930 Ft. Above The Sea Level Has A Brilliant Color Variation Including Deep Blue, Turquoise Etc. Spend Some Time On The Banks  Of Pangong Lake. This Famous Blue Brackish Lake Of Pangong Is 5/6 Kms Wide And Over 144 Kms Long And Is Shared By Two Countries (30% India And 70% China). Enjoy Hot Lunch At The Banks Of Pangong Lake. Night in Tent on Pangong Lake.(B,L,D)
25th  May                   Pangong – Leh (4 Hrs One Way – 140 Kms)
Morning After Breakfast around 9 -10 Am leave For Leh. On the way we will visit Hemis Monastery & Sindhu Ghat & back to Leh. Overnight Stay at the Hotel. (B,L,D)
26th May                 Tour of Khardungla Pass 18380 Ft. Nubra Valley and Hundur Sand Dunes (5 Hrs – 120 Kms)
After Breakfast around 8 Am drive to Nubra Valley Drive 120km 4/5hrs via Khardungla (Highest Motorable road in the World, 18,380 ft) Arrive at Hundur by Afternoon. Rest of the day, Post lunch free to explore Diskit, Hundur Villages and camel Safari (On Own) in Sand Dunes between Diskit and Hunder Village. Overnight stay at the camp. (B,L,D)
27th May                After Breakfast proceed to Diskit monastery which is 515 years old  Nubra Valley – Leh (5 Hrs)
After Breakfast around 9 Am visit Diskit Monastery and drive back to Leh by same Route, crossing Khardungla Pass. Reach Leh by afternoon. Evening free time at Leisure to explore Leh market. Overnight stay at the hotel. (B,L,D)
28th May                    Leh  – Delhi
Check out from Hotel & leave for Airport. Fly to Delhi. Tour Concludes with new friends & Happy Memories.
